Speech & Audio AI
6 claim(s)
AI-powered speech and audio tools — automatic speech recognition (ASR), text-to-speech, voice cloning, and AI-driven audio production — are reshaping how newsrooms produce, translate, and distribute audio journalism. The technology spans from established transcription workflows to the frontier of synthetic voice generation.
What's happening
Speech AI adoption in newsrooms sits on a spectrum. At one end, audio transcription is a settled, standard use — most large publishers have integrated ASR into their workflows for years. At the other, AI voice cloning is moving from experiment to production: small newsrooms already automate audio briefings with synthetic voices, and ventures like Channel 1 disclose hybrid workflows using 3D-scanned subjects and multilingual synthetic anchors. The voice cloning market has surged to an estimated $2.4B (2025), projected to reach $9.6B by 2030, with ElevenLabs valued at $11B after its 2026 Series D.
What the evidence shows
On clean, studio-quality audio, ASR is near-solved — leading models achieve word error rates around 2.3%. But accuracy degrades sharply on noisy, overlapping, or in-the-wild speech, and performance on accented and multilingual broadcast audio remains poorly documented in public benchmarks. Voice cloning research has produced a striking finding: cloned voices are not neutral reproductions. A 2026 study shows that voice cloning models systematically apply style transfer, making cloned voices sound more authoritative and trustworthy than the originals, while homogenizing accent, speaking rate, and vocal diversity. Courts are beginning to engage: a July 2025 federal ruling allowed voice actors' right-of-publicity claims against AI voiceover startup Lovo to proceed.
What's contested
The central tension is between utility and harm. Voice cloning enables rapid multilingual content and accessibility, but research finds 70% of adults cannot reliably distinguish cloned from real voices, and deepfake voice fraud attempts rose 1,300% year-over-year in 2025. The EU AI Act's transparency obligations for synthetic voice providers take effect from August 2026, but the gap between regulatory mandates and measurable compliance is wide. Cross-lingual voice preservation — where a speaker's identity is maintained across languages — is technically demonstrated in research but lacks auditable newsroom deployment evidence.
What to watch
Whether the Lovo lawsuit establishes durable precedent for vocal likeness rights; whether newsroom voice-cloning policies converge on mandatory disclosure standards; and whether ASR benchmarks begin covering accented and multilingual broadcast audio — the current blind spot for newsroom deployment decisions.
